Tony Romo bought offensive linemen Louis Vuitton bags

Cowboys-Louis-Vuitton

The Dallas Cowboys have arguably the best offensive line in the NFL this season, and the big guys have been getting the recognition they deserve. A little over a week ago, the O-line received $1,300 iMac computers from Demarco Murray, who leads the NFL in rushing. On Friday, Tony Romo showed his appreciation with the gift of luggage.

Romo gave all of his blockers — including tight ends — Louis Vuitton travel bags. Louis Vuitton travel bags for men can cost as much as a few thousand dollars each. The Cowboys leave for London on Monday.

“Appreciate it,” Jason Witten said, per Todd Archer of ESPNDallas.com. “Timing is now for the London trip, I’m assuming. So perfect timing.”

The bags came with a London travel book in case any of the lucky recipients wanted to do some sight-seeing before their game against the Jacksonville Jaguars next weekend.

“They’re taking care of us this year,” left guard Ronald Leary said when asked about the gifts from Murray and Romo. “We appreciate it.”

It should be noted that Romo was sacked a season-high five times on Monday night and took a knee to the back that could result in him missing Sunday’s game against the Arizona Cardinals. Maybe this is his way of trying to butter up his pass protectors.
